Postgame Quotes at Louisville

Chattanooga Basketball Postgame Quotes
Chattanooga at No. 5 Louisville
KFC Yum! Center – Louisville, Ky.
Monday – Nov. 21, 2016


Head Coach Jim Foster
On playing well as the game went on tonight:
"The last two minutes of the first quarter and the second, third and fourth quarters, I thought we played hard.  I thought we came out afraid and that is nonsense.  We play great teams, this is just another one. 

"We dealt with that and then you have to make up your mind how hard you are going to play.  How much you are going to push and how much are you going to help each other.  We did a much better job of that.

"Now it is a four-quarter job.  Understand, that is the way you are supposed to practice.  That is the way you need to be every day and we will grow from that. 

"It is not getting any easier.  We need people there on Friday.  We need a big crowd on Friday.  We are playing a really, really good basketball teams.  We are bringing really, really good basketball teams into Chattanooga.  I would like to see folks there." 

On the play of Queen Alford:
"She needs to just be aggressive and take advantage of opportunities."

On the play of Jasmine Joyner: 
"
Jas really struggled with some point-blank shots early.  She just needs to slow down.  Her energy with 15 rebounds, seven blocks and three steals is just terrific, but she had some very makeable shots. 
She has a tendency to just get excited.  She is an excitable kind of person, but she has to get that under control.  You can't be excited on offense.  You have to be relaxed on offense."

On the overall effort of the team:
"
I thought our effort was better.  I thought we played harder.  Against a team that dominates the boards, we were even with them on the boards.  With our foul situation, we played a really soft, aggressive man-to-man and that made a difference.
We rushed a lot of our threes early and that was due to their quick ness.  From the point of view of an experience that can make us a better team coming in here and playing as hard as we played, that is a good sign.  Understating that we have more teams like this still to play.  If we can get this kind of mentality that that is who we are, we are going to be successful."
